Bottled Water – Pouring Resources Down the Drain

Written by Emily Arnold and Janet Larsen – www.earth-policy.org
The global consumption of bottled water reached 154 billion liters (41 billion gallons) in 2004, up 57 percent from the 98 billion liters consumed five years earlier. Even in areas where tap water is safe to drink, demand for bottled water is increasing—producing unnecessary garbage and consuming [...]
